首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Js深入理解
订阅
多笋123
更多收藏集
微信扫码分享
微信
新浪微博
QQ
9篇文章 · 0订阅
线上紧急Bug:80%前端会遇到的数据精度问题
在某个开开心心上班的周五,突然测试老大找过说昨天上线的项目有大问题,数据都不显示了,早餐都来不及吃赶紧找原因...
通过可视化的方式搞懂 JavaScript 事件循环
我们知道,JavaScript 是一个单线程、非阻塞、异步、解释型语言。JavaScript 需要一个解释器将 JavaScript 代码转换成机器码。解释器也被称为引擎,例如我们常说的 chrome
JS 暂时性死区
ES6 规定,如果代码区块中存在 let 和 const 命令声明的变量,这个区块对这些变量从一开始就形成了封闭作用域,直到声明语句完成,这些变量才能被访问(获取或设置),否则会报错Reference
「前端进阶」从多线程到Event Loop全面梳理
几乎在每一本JS相关的书籍中,都会说JS是单线程的,JS是通过事件队列(Event Loop)的方式来实现异步回调的。 对很多初学JS的人来说,根本搞不清楚单线程的JS为什么拥有异步的能力,所以,我试图从进程、线程的角度来解释这个问题。 计算机的核心是CPU,它承担了所有的计算…
2024年了,再搞不懂JS隐式转换就只能转行了
首先咱们看2道面试题。 小伙伴们可以试着猜测一下打印出来是什么,如果跟你们心目中答案一样,那恭喜你隐式转换毕业了。如果只做对了其中一两道,那么证明还是没有完全搞懂,文章接着往下看吧! 首先触发隐式转换
js闭包的6种应用场景!!!这下会用了
什么是闭包? 如果一个函数访问了此函数的父级及父级以上的作用域变量,那么这个函数就是一个闭包。闭包会创建一个包含外部函数作用域变量的环境,并将其保存在内存中,这意味着,即使外部函数已经执行完毕,闭
✨从柯里化讲起,一网打尽 JavaScript 重要的高阶函数
可见由函数式启发的“闭包”、“柯里化”思想对 JavaScript 有多重要。几乎所有的高阶函数都离不开闭包、参数由多转逐一的柯里化传参思想。
面试官:请你展开说说js中的垃圾回收机制
前言 在现在的面试中,无论是大中小厂,垃圾回收机制已经是老生常谈的问题了,那么垃圾回收到底是什么?本篇文章继续针对这一问题展开探讨,如有不足的地方欢迎大家批评指正。 一、基础概念 (1)js内存的生命
观察者模式 vs 发布订阅模式,千万不要再混淆了
观察者模式和发布订阅模式作为开发中经常使用到的模式,小包一直不能做到很好的区分,前几天在听公开课时,老师详细讲解两种模式,发现自己还是没有吃透。于是小包本文就通过多个案例,形象的解读两种模式,一次吃透